Semi-Automatic Function

Semi-automatic turntables operate with a combination of manual and automatic functions. Here's how it works:

  1. Manual Start: To begin playing a record, manually place the tonearm onto the desired groove of the record, or at the beginning.
  2. Manual Stop: If you would like to stop playback mid record, manually lift the tonearm from the record and return it to its rest position.
  3. Automatic Return: Unlike fully manual turntables where you must manually lift and return the tonearm after playback, SpinDeck 2 has a automatic return feature. Once the tonearm reaches the end of the record, a mechanism lifts it from the groove and returns it to its rest position, automatically for your convenience.

In essence, SpinDeck 2 provides the convenience of automatic tonearm return at the end of a record while still allowing manual operation. This design offers a balance between automation and user control.
